LTE and Private 5G Networks: Solve Today's Problems, But Be Mindful of Tomorrow's Challenges

RCRWirelessNews, Wednesday, April 3rd, 2024

After attending last month's Mobile World Congress in Barcelona, it was clear that many technology vendors and service providers see private 5G as the solution to solve many operational challenges that affect business operations.

Make no mistake; the rollout of private 5G networks in the United States is underway, but in terms of solving the overwhelming majority of challenges that businesses face today, private cellular 4G LTE is clearly up to the task.

Of course, there are very obvious benefits coming from 5G - such as expanded bandwidth, higher throughput and low latency. But the stark reality is that only a subset of enterprise customers that either use or are considering private cellular technology can fully utilize these 5G advantages. In most instances, existing 4G LTE networks have more than enough capacity to support industrial needs, while also solving the market's most pressing problem: consistent and reliable connectivity.
